    BEIJING, July 16 (Xinhua) — Chinese Vice President Xi Jinping has detailed main tasks for the training of officials in the next few years as the Communist Party of China (CPC) launched a new round of major training programs for its cadres.

Xi Jinping (C), Chinese Vice President and a member of the Standing Committee of the Political Bureau of the Communist Party of China (CPC) Central Committee, addresses a national conference on official training in Beijing, capital of China, July 16, 2008. (Xinhua Photo)

    He said relevant training institutions must put "quality and efficacy" of official training to a more prominent place and promote innovation in this regard.

    Xi, also a member of the Standing Committee of the Political Bureau of the CPC Central Committee, made the remarks when addressing a national conference on official training.

    The training should focus on "fortifying conviction and belief" of officials and enhancing their "capability of governing and leading scientific development" in their jurisdiction, he said.

    The major tasks of the major new training program for cadres in the next few years are to equip officials with a system of theories of socialism with Chinese characteristics, the CPC’s lines, principle and policies, the country’s laws and regulations, the experience of the reform and opening-up, as well as the CPC’s fine traditions, Xi stressed.
